Choppy Seas Filmed Off Barry This Morning

By Alex Jones

21st Aug 2020 | Local News

Spectacular scenes in along the Promenade this morning as waves crashed in from a choppy sea.

Spectators filmed impressive footage across the seafront. Geraint Evans, whose photo captured the sheer force of the Waves, commented: "Too wild for swimming this morning."

The extreme conditions come two days after RNLI Wales urged towns across the south coast to remain vigilant. A gale warning has been issued in the Lundy shipping area.

If you see anyone in trouble, call 999 immediately.
